    Depends what you mean by best - if you're looking to make money probably Pacific or Empire/Party would be the road to go down.

    I play on William Hill, Victor Chandler, Prima, Party, Empire, Pacific, Full Tilt Poker, Pokerroom and Pokerstars (not that I have a problem or anything) but I spend most of my time on Pokerstars - good, stable software, the best tournament structures, easy and logical navigation, the facility to host private rooms, excellent customer support and a higher standard of play (overall) than most other sites I've encountered. I also like the layout and the fact that you can upload your own avatar.

    The only real downside to speak of is they rarely offer signup/reload bonuses, but they do reward their regular players with a Frequent Player Points (FPP) system - FPPs are redeemable for tournament entries, baseball caps and a plethora of other goodies. A bit like 'Airmiles' but without the hassle of swiping a card.
